Here is what most homeowners do not realize about HVAC equipment in Gerber. The efficiency rating on a new HVAC system is the efficiency it achieves under laboratory test conditions in Gerber, CA. What you actually experience in your home is the efficiency the installation produces in Gerber. A high-efficiency system installed with an incorrect refrigerant charge operates at a significantly lower efficiency than its rating in Gerber, CA. A correctly charged system installed on ductwork with significant leakage delivers a fraction of its rated cooling capacity to the living spaces in Gerber. And a correctly charged, correctly installed system that is the wrong size for your home's actual load produces persistent humidity problems or inadequate comfort regardless of its efficiency rating in Gerber, CA. The equipment rating is the ceiling. The installation quality determines whether you get anywhere near it in Gerber.

Why Correct HVAC Sizing Is the Most Important Installation Decision in Gerber, CA

What an Oversized System Does to Your Home in Gerber

An oversized HVAC system reaches the thermostat setpoint quickly without adequately conditioning the rest of the home or removing adequate humidity from the circulated air in Gerber, CA. In cooling mode, the short cycles an oversized system produces do not run long enough to dehumidify effectively in Gerber. Indoor humidity remains elevated despite the air conditioner running in Gerber, CA. The home feels cold and clammy rather than cool and comfortable in Gerber. And the frequent startup and shutdown cycles accumulate wear on the compressor that shortens the system's service life in Gerber, CA.

What an Undersized System Does to Your Home in Gerber, CA

An undersized HVAC system runs continuously in extreme weather without reaching the thermostat setpoint in Gerber. The home is consistently warmer in summer and cooler in winter than the thermostat calls for during the most demanding weather in Gerber, CA. The system runs at maximum capacity for extended periods, consuming maximum energy while delivering inadequate comfort in Gerber.

Why Manual J and Manual D Are Both Required for a Complete Installation in Gerber

Manual J determines the correct system capacity. Manual D designs the duct system. Manual J determines the correct system capacity in Gerber, CA. Manual D designs the duct system to correctly distribute the conditioned air that capacity produces to each room in Gerber. A correctly sized system installed on an incorrectly designed duct system cannot deliver the right amount of conditioned air to each room regardless of its overall capacity in Gerber, CA. Both calculations are required for a complete installation that performs correctly at the room level in Gerber. When Efficiency Gains Justify Proactive Replacement in Gerber

Replacing a 10 SEER system with an 18 SEER system reduces cooling energy consumption by approximately 44 percent for the same cooling output in Gerber, CA. Over a 15-year service life, those savings accumulate to a total that contributes substantially to the payback on the replacement investment in Gerber.
